I have a 12volt 82 HJ47 - Aussie import.
Ran for 3k miles then after the import, I can not get the plugs to glow. I have been following the wrong diagrams and have now started to trace each wire and make my own diagram. I have multiple troubleshooting guides for the super glow system.
In short, I have a relay and solenoid mounted near the front apron. The relay is working but I found a broken wire on the solenoid coil. After fixing that I realized I am not getting 12volts on the coil wires of the solenoid when the key is turned on. The +coil wire goes into the preheating timer. It seems to me the preheating timer gets its power from the alternator? Can you troubleshoot the preheat timer?
Is this the correct diagram for the 10.5 volt glowplugs? I only see troubleshooting guides for the super glow system.
This diagram does not show the two relays, both resistors nor the Pre-Heating timer. I have searched many online manuals not to find a circuit like my vehicle.
